Confusion on type of capacitor to be used in SG3524.

While using SG3524, for buck converter, I need to give a feedback to the error amplifier at pin 1. At the output of the error amplifier  (pin 9) I have the Caps and Resistors for compensation. Do the capacitors here need to be ceramic disc capacitors necessarily? Or any specific type of capacitors?? Cannot I use Electrolytic aluminium capacitors? The problem arises because I got ceramic bead capacitors of value only 0.1 microfarad, whereas I need a capacitor of very high value there (I might be wrong).
